135-Year-Old Charminar Clock Faces Damage from Pigeons

The 135-year-old clock on the eastern side of Hyderabad’s Charminar was found damaged by visitors on Monday. Reports indicate that pigeons may have caused the damage. The historic clock is an important symbol of the city, and efforts will likely be made to restore it soon.
